Стоит ли платить за Linux?
В отличие от Microsoft Windows и Apple macOS, Linux – это не просто операционная система, которая может питать ваш компьютер. Linux – это также подход к разработке программного обеспечения: открытый и общедоступный. Но учитывая, сколько времени и усилий уходит на разработку Linux, вопрос возникает снова и снова для различных организаций. Как мы за все это платим?
Затем вам задают этот вопрос. Стоит ли платить за Linux и какие способы вы бы хотели рассмотреть?
Как в настоящее время оплачивается Linux
Технически не существует единой операционной системы, известной как Linux. Linux – это ядро, часть вашей системы, которая позволяет аппаратному обеспечению вашего компьютера взаимодействовать с тем, что вы видите на экране.
Существует целая экосистема бесплатного программного обеспечения с открытым исходным кодом, которое объединяется для создания функциональной настольной операционной системы. Когда кто-то или организация объединяет это программное обеспечение и делает его доступным для других, конечный результат известен как дистрибутив Linux, или для краткости «дистрибутив».
Когда большинство из нас устанавливает Linux, мы никому ничего не платим. Мы заходим на веб-сайт дистрибутива Linux, загружаем файл образа, записываем его на USB-накопитель и используем его для замены или дополнения операционной системы, которая была предустановлена на нашем компьютере.
Трудно взимать с людей прямую плату за дистрибутив Linux или программное обеспечение с открытым исходным кодом в целом. Поскольку любой может просматривать, редактировать и распространять код, это означает, что каждый может сделать бесплатную (по стоимости) альтернативу программному обеспечению, которое вы пытаетесь продать.
Но в экосистеме Linux все еще циркулирует куча денег. Вот некоторые из наиболее распространенных моделей, которые некоторые проекты используют для зарабатывания денег:
- Пожертвования и спонсорство : большинство проектов бесплатного программного обеспечения принимают пожертвования. Довольно много зрелых проектов существует преимущественно за счет этой формы финансирования. Некоторые примеры включают само ядро Linux и основные среды рабочего стола, такие как GNOME и KDE.
- Контракты на поддержку : Самый проверенный метод для компании, разрабатывающей исключительно бесплатное программное обеспечение с открытым исходным кодом, – это взимать плату за контракты на поддержку. Это означает, что любой желающий может бесплатно установить ОС, но если им потребуется какая-либо помощь или настройка, за это придется заплатить. Этот подход обычно нацелен на корпоративных клиентов, таких как предприятия, правительства и школы. Прежде чем стать дочерней компанией IBM, Red Hat смогла стать крупнейшей компанией с открытым исходным кодом и первой с годовым доходом более миллиарда долларов за счет контрактов на поддержку.
- Платите, сколько хотите : этот подход получил известность с Humble Indie Bundle, который привлек большие суммы денег для разработчиков и имел побочный эффект в виде переноса различных игр в Linux. В проекте elementary эта модель была принята как для elementary OS, так и для приложений в AppCenter . Хотя разработчики приложений не совсем плавают в деньгах, команда elementary OS заработала достаточно денег, помимо пожертвований, чтобы поддержать одного или двух штатных сотрудников.
- Плата за версии, отличные от Linux : это более свежий метод, который получил распространение с появлением магазинов приложений. Бесплатное программное обеспечение для Linux иногда появляется в коммерческих магазинах приложений с ценником, например, платные версии программы цифрового рисования Krita в Windows Store, Steam и Epic Store.
- Поставщики оборудования : некоторые компании продают компьютеры с предустановленным Linux и используют часть прибыли для разработки своих собственных дистрибутивов и других разработчиков Linux. Примеры включают System76, Pop! _OS и Purism с PureOS.
Многие проекты используют комбинацию этих различных вариантов финансирования. Но для большинства домашних пользователей Linux, устанавливающих Linux на свой компьютер, если они не решат сделать пожертвование, деньги не переходят из рук в руки.
Можно ли заплатить напрямую за копию Linux?
Конечно, есть люди, которые готовы продать вам копию дистрибутива Linux. Вы можете найти установочные диски, например, на eBay. Часто это просто кто-то, не связанный с проектом, записывающий установочный образ на диск для вас, а затем взимающий с вас компенсацию за диск и их время.
Если вас пугает процесс создания собственного установочного носителя, это альтернативный способ установить Linux в вашей системе. Хотя получение программного обеспечения от третьей стороны всегда связано с определенным риском и доверием.
С развитием облачных вычислений появилась возможность платить за виртуальную копию Linux, которую вы запускаете удаленно на чужой машине. Они известны как виртуальные облачные рабочие столы, но по сути это плата за установку Linux, а не на ваше собственное оборудование.
Есть несколько дистрибутивов Linux, которые напрямую предлагают платные версии, например Zorin OS . В таких случаях вы можете получить несколько предустановленных дополнительных программных функций (которые бесплатные пользователи могут выбрать установку вручную, если захотят) или дополнительную поддержку.
Вы также можете купить версии Linux для работы в подсистеме Windows для Linux, например Fedora Remix для WSL .
Самый простой вариант – это, пожалуй, тот же вариант, что и большинство людей покупают копии Windows и macOS, то есть компьютер с предустановленным Linux.
Что насчет программного обеспечения для Linux?
Хотя подавляющее большинство программ, доступных для Linux, являются бесплатными и имеют открытый исходный код, на платформу приходит все больше проприетарного программного обеспечения. Вы можете найти такое программное обеспечение в Steam, Humble Bundle и Epic Games Store. Большинство из них – игры. Вы также можете приобрести некоторые программы прямо на сайтах разработчиков.
И, опять же, есть также магазин приложений elementary с неограниченной оплатой, AppCenter.
Стоит ли платить за Linux?
Ответ не так однозначен, как кажется. Да, при нынешней структуре большинства наших обществ людям необходимо получать заработную плату или какой-либо другой доход, чтобы сводить концы с концами.
Люди могут захотеть внести больший вклад в Linux, но финансовые ограничения вынуждают их работать в компании, которая вместо этого будет платить им за разработку собственного кода. Создание культуры, в которой люди платят за программное обеспечение, побуждает все больше компаний платить разработчикам за создание приложений и игр для Linux.
С другой стороны, очень многое из того, что сделало экосистему Linux такой, какая она есть, – это то, как программное обеспечение разрабатывается и свободно распространяется. Ожидание оплаты может разрушиться при мысли о том, что весь этот код в равной степени принадлежит всем.
И это могло бы принести больше проприетарного программного обеспечения в ОС, создав среду, в которой у большинства пользователей может быть бесплатная операционная система, но большинство устанавливаемых ими приложений являются такими же закрытыми и нарушающими конфиденциальность, как те, что есть на платформах Apple, Google и Microsoft.
Сколько вы должны платить за Linux?
То, как вы относитесь к этому вопросу, может также отражать то, насколько вы довольны нынешним положением вещей. Вы уже пользуетесь преимущественно бесплатным программным обеспечением с открытым исходным кодом, большая часть которого создана исключительно для Linux? У вас осталось желание перейти на Linux, но есть одно платное проприетарное приложение, от которого вы зависите, но которое недоступно?
Вам нравятся ценности, лежащие в основе бесплатного программного обеспечения, или вы просто выбираете Linux, потому что считаете, что он предлагает лучший опыт, и вы хотите иметь все те же приложения, которые были бы у вас на других платформах? То, как вы ответите на эти вопросы, может повлиять на то, как и сколько вы готовы платить.